Equity of Redemption
The right of a mortgagor to reclaim property on which a mortgage exists by repaying the debt before a foreclosure sale.
Legal Title
The legal entitlement to possess property, safeguarded and upheld by the legal system.
Acceleration Clause
A clause in a debt instrument (e.g., a mortgage) that requires the payment of the balance of the debt on the happening of a specific event, such as default on an installment payment.
